DELAY: The time before the camera switches to Day
RET
or Night mode after detecting a switching threshold.
D-->N (Day to Night): The relative light level at which
the camera switches to Night mode. The higher the
value, the darker the lighting (the lower the lux
threshold) must be before the camera switches.
Set D-->N should be set at least 3 less than N-->D.
N-->D (Night to Day): The relative light level at which
the camera switches to Day mode. The lower the
value, the brighter the lighting (the higher the lux
threshold) must be before the camera switches.
